Not to hijack (should start a metals section maybe)

From my inquiries with GoldCo, they are really geared towards bulk purchases, like moving your savings/retirement over. If you're looking at a purchase of less than roughly $10k, I've had their reps tell me they're not going to be the best deal. When you are moving big numbers, that's when they start to make sense.

I don't know if they push eagles or what not but they generally don't have a good selection like you can get through most of the online sellers.

I used to follow this closely and had a spreadsheet tracking where the best deals were on 1oz rounds and constitutional.

Here was my summary from back in February and I think for the most part, these rankings still stand.

Bullion Standard with the $35/month (cancel anytime) membership gets you by far the best price for 1oz rounds, even without the pro membership they are generally the best.

1789317318045.webp

Money Metals is 2nd to worst, almost always, with APMEX being almost always the most expensive

As for constitutional, usually Standard, Hero, Bullion . com, and Bullion Express lead the pack. But I get my constitutional locally for usually way better than any online place (typically $4 under spot), my LCS has been in the business for a very long time and doesn't need to squeeze people. I can usually buy 1oz rounds at $1 over spot
